As a Unit Aide Lead for the surgical team at Banner University Medical Center -Tuscon, you will help impact patient care directly by providing a clean and risk free surgical environment. You will clean the operating rooms after each surgery, stock the OR's with supplies, transport patients, and other operational tasks as needed. You will have the opportunity to work in a level one trauma facility with varying types of surgical services in a positive team environment that promotes growth and learning.

Full Time: 40 hours a week, 5 days a week, varied day shift schedule

POSITION SUMMARY

This position provides leadership and training for unit aides while working as a member of the Unit Aide team. Assists with oversight of activities relating to collection, inventory, cleaning and distribution of medical supplies and patient care equipment for the unit.

CORE FUNCTIONS

1. Ensures that staffing plans are carried out properly and that the unit is staffed appropriately.  Assists with department-wide projects and ensures consistent service delivery standards in all aspects of Unit Aide responsibilities.  Provides input to leader relating to quality and timeliness of work performed by Unit Aide staff.

2.Works closely with leader to recruit, train, retain and develop the Unit Aide team members, fostering a culture that reflects the core values and operational policies of the department and company. 

3. May supervise staff in the absence of leader.  Makes work assignments and respond to immediate needs by moving staff, as needed.

4. Assists leader in performing quality assurance inspections for review and correction of deficiencies.

5. Distributes cleaning supplies as needed and takes inventories in assigned areas.

6. May perform cleaning functions in areas including operating rooms, specialty areas, room turnovers and/or common areas.

7. Works independently with general supervision.  Customers include staff, patients, physicians, vendors, and visitors.  Oversees daily activities of a team of Unit Aides.  Makes staffing assignments in absence of the leader; coordinates cleaning projects as assigned, assists with on-the-job training, provides input to performance evaluations. 

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S

BLS certification required

High school diploma/GED or equivalent working knowledge.

Requires skills and abilities typically attained by two or more years of healthcare experience. 

Knowledge of patient-related supplies, materials, equipment and aseptic techniques.

Must have leadership skills and be able to communicate effectively verbally and in writing. 

Working knowledge of medical terminology required.

Requires the ability to work independently with minimal supervision. 

Must serve as a role model to others in customer service skills, safe work practices, and infection control including hand hygiene.
